Dubai is expanding its network of electric vehicle charging stations.

The Dubai Electricity and Water Authority (DEWA) has partnered with public parking operator Parkin to increase the number of green chargers for electric vehicles in several prime locations.

These charging stations will be located in parking areas and areas managed by Parkin.

The MoU was signed by Waleed bin Salman, Executive Vice President of Business Development and Excellence at DEWA, ​​and Mohamed Abdulla Al Ali, CEO of Parkin, in the presence of Saeed Mohammed Al Tayer, Managing Director and CEO of DEWA, ​​and Ahmed Bahrozyan, Chairman. by Parkin.

Al Tayer said the number of electric vehicles in Dubai reached more than 30,000 by the end of April 2024, while the number of participants in DEWA’s EV Green Charger program exceeded 15,000 in March 2024.

“Operating over 197,000 parking spaces in Dubai, Parkin’s market-leading position, operational excellence and innovative technology will enable us to drive the growth of electric vehicle infrastructure while also delivering environmental and decarbonization benefits “added Bahrozyan.
